Overview

CFR Cluj, also known as SC Fotbal Club CFR 1907 Cluj SA, is a professional football club based in Cluj-Napoca, Romania. Founded in 1907, the club's primary industry is sports, with a business model focusing on commerce. CFR Cluj is publicly owned, and the club is considered active.

The organization is headquartered in Cluj-Napoca, Romania, at str. Romulus Vuia, nr. 23, 400214. CFR Cluj owns the Stadionul Dr. Constantin Rădulescu.

Some key people associated with CFR Cluj include Andrei Burcă, Cristian Manea, Kristian Dimitrov, Daniel Graovac, Ciprian Deac, and Marko Dugandžić, among others.

The club is known by various nicknames, such as Alb-vișiniii (The White and Burgundies), Campioana Provinciei (The Provincial Champion), Ceferiștii (The CFR People), Clujenii (The Cluj People), and Feroviarii (The Railwaymen).
